#38c4e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#38c4e6 is composed of 22% red, 76.9%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 14.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 191.7 degrees, a saturation of 77.7% and a lightness of 56.1%. #38c4e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#0089cd.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

Shades and Tints of #38c4e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080a is the darkest color, while #f8f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#38c4e6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9090 is the less saturated color, while #27cef7 is the most saturated one.
